3D printing settings

Layer Height: 0.2mm for a balance between print quality and speed. You can adjust this based on your preference, with lower layer heights providing higher detail but longer print times.
Infill Density: 10-20% infill should be sufficient for structural integrity while minimizing material usage. Increase if you desire a stronger model.
Supports: Depending on the model's overhangs and complex geometry, you may need supports. Use automatic support generation in your slicer software.
Printing Temperature: Varies depending on the filament material. For PLA, a temperature range of 190-220°C is common. ABS typically prints at 230-260°C, while resin settings depend on the specific resin brand and printer.
Print Speed: Start with a moderate speed of around 50mm/s for reliable prints. Adjust as needed based on your printer's capabilities and quality requirements.
Adhesion: Ensure proper bed adhesion by using a heated bed (if applicable) and appropriate adhesion aids like a brim or raft
